Output 31bc8708ed45cf4d68fbc8cba8a13dc6dd866329ef1c99f9d13717538e5cae4c:1

value
134603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 131cd1ced62cf274678ea7a436540e1278495def OP_EQUAL
address
33S5Hc9ct6U5uvUtqD3rhb6i44rL2ax347
transaction
31bc8708ed45cf4d68fbc8cba8a13dc6dd866329ef1c99f9d13717538e5cae4c
confirmations
285590
spent
true